Recently, the dedicated staff team brought home again the DDLETB (Dublin and Dún Laoghaire Education and Training Board, of which SCFE is a constituent college) Student Society Five- A-Side Football Trophy. The staff were thrilled to be joined by former SCFE students Aine O’Gorman and Stephen Foley, who helped lead them to victory.
Aine has had a fantastic international football career and has made a profound impact on the growth of sports in this country, having played for 12 years at senior International level, with 100 Caps and 13 goals for Ireland.
Stephen is a former Aston Villa footballer and is currently doing his teaching practice back where he started, in SCFE as part of his Degree in Education and Training (DCU). Both of these super athletes are also successful personal trainers.
And they are not alone! The Fitness, Sports and Personal Training department have seen its former and current students achieve huge success in their field of study. These include Ali Meeke who is currently a member of the Women’s Irish Hockey team, and who represented Ireland in the final of the World Cup in 2018; Stephanie Roche who plays for Ireland’s Women’s National Football team, as well as the Italian Club CF Florentia; Damian Darker, Irish Kick Boxing Champion and part-owner of The Lab, Performance and Nutrition, and Rebecca Nagle, Irish Basketball player who this year will marry Damian – and yes, you’ve guessed it – they met at SCFE!
Others include Jonathon Wright Harris, Strength and Conditioning Coach for Bristol RFC; Nicky Byrne, a footballer who has now also opened his own business, The Hub in Sallynoggin; and current students Ken Doyle and Sean Mari, currently fighting in the Amateur Boxing Senior Elite Championships.

All courses, either of one or two-year duration and run from September to May, are quality assured and certified by national and international awarding bodies, including QQI at level 5 and Level 6, International Therapy Exercise Council (ITEC), and other relevant awards. All are recognised on the National Framework of Qualifications. Students of all SCFE courses may progress to Higher Education Institutes and Universities.

No CAO points are required for entry to Sallynoggin College, and students can use QQI Level 5 & Level 6 as stepping stones to apply for CAO places. This also allows Applied Leaving Certificate students to access Degree level further study. Recognised for SUSI Grants.
